The psychology - why impulse views can become real buying intent
Impulse views are honest signals of curiosity. For Gen Z and Gen Alpha users, curiosity plus low effort equals action. Three psychological mechanics drive conversion when the environment supports them:
Micro-commitment - a single tap in-app is a tiny behavioral investment; minimizing follow-up steps converts micro-commitment into purchase.
Immediate gratification - native payments and clear delivery promises satisfy the brain’s desire for instant outcomes.
Social proof and authenticity - creator demos and social proof shorten the trust curve; people buy when someone they trust shows the product working.
TikTok Shop ads combine these psychological levers with productized engineering so that impulse bias becomes reliable intent.

The creative rules that turn a 6-second curiosity into a purchase
To convert impulses, creative must follow a tight commerce protocol:
Hook (0–2s) - stop the scroll with a promise or visceral visual.
Offer signal (2–5s) - show price/promo and “ships by” or “2-day delivery” to convey certainty.
Proof (5–10s) - rapid demo or creator testimonial; social proof matters more than polish.
Checkout cue (10–15s) - explicit CTA: “Tap Shop - buy in-app” with visible offer.
Loop/finish - design the end to loop (visual callback) so rewatches increase distribution.
Each creative must be mapped to an exact offer_id so the image, price and variant you see in the ad are the ones the user buys. For scale, feed creative into a performance creative system that produces many variants and enforces the commerce protocol.

Measurement - the KPIs that matter for impulse-to-intent
Shift your dashboard away from clicks and toward revenue and reliability:
GMV-per-impression - how much revenue each impression generates.
Conversion efficiency - orders per impression or per view in native checkout.
Reservation success rate - % of checkout attempts where inventory reservation succeeded.
AOV & bundle take rate - measures effectiveness of bundle offers.
TikTok Shop ROAS - agent-attributed revenue divided by ad spend via S2S reconciliation.
Cohort retention - fold Shop cohorts into retention flows to assess long-term value.
Run randomized holdouts or geo-blackouts for lift tests to ensure you’re capturing incremental revenue rather than channel cannibalization.
Operational playbook - a 30-day sprint
Week 1 - Readiness
Validate feed:
offer_id, price, inventory & fulfillment fields.Stand up reservation endpoint and S2S postback for provenance.
Brief creators on commerce protocol and prepare 3 commerce templates.
Week 2 - Pilot creative
Produce 15–30 variants for 6–8 pilot SKUs mapped to offers.
Launch low-budget Shop ads and track reservation and conversion rates.
Week 3 - Measurement & iterate
Prune poor performers, scale top hooks and run a small lift test.
Start whitelisting high-performing creators for Shop amplification.
Week 4 - Scale & govern
Scale winners incrementally and add bundles.
Automate feed validations and creative-offer checks.
Begin integrating Shop cohorts into retention sequences.
Coordinate budgets and bidding strategies with your paid media plan and ensure creative ops integrates with performance pipelines.
Pitfalls and how to avoid them
Inventory latency - implement real-time sync and reservations.
Creative mismatch - enforce automated checks to ensure ad visuals, price and variant match the offer.
No provenance - without S2S postbacks you cannot trust Shop ROAS; implement before scaling.
Over-reliance on single creators - scale via micro-creator networks and standardized briefs to avoid single-point risk.
FAQ - impulse to intent on TikTok Shop
Can impulse purchases really become loyal customers?
Yes, when you couple efficient Shop conversion with retention flows that convert that first buy into a repeat relationship. Track cohort behavior and use post-purchase messaging to lift LTV.
How many creative variants should I test?
Start with 15–30 variants per SKU-family; short-form platforms require many variants to avoid fatigue and to find the right hook.
Do I need creators to make this work?
Creators greatly accelerate conversion because they provide trust, but small brands can succeed with strong commerce-native brand creatives and clear offer signals. Creator whitelisting scales authenticity for paid runs.
How do provenance tokens improve measurement?
Provenance tokens are returned at checkout and reconciled server-to-server so you can deterministically map an impression or offer to an order. That removes much of the attribution uncertainty found in click-based funnels.
